## Deployment

RestockPilot, the vending-machine restock planner from Quillhaven Systems, deploys as a single container behind the Fenwick gateway. Please verify the staging smoke suite passes before promoting, and confirm the route-optimizer cache is warmed — cold starts delay the morning planning run. Tag releases with the sprint label. The configuration values the service expects in its environment are shown below.

settings of tahof-yahap:
quenwyn:
  log_level: error
  metrics_host: metrics.quenwyn.lumiclabs.internal
  pool_size: 8

Runbook: Greywharf account recovery (contractor edition). Context: the Tallysheet spreadsheet export spikes memory on rows >50k; killed workers can lock the exporting account. To recover: verify the lock flag, clear the stuck job from the Quill queue, then unlock via the admin shell. The shell prompts once. If your session token is expired, recovery requires the standing passphrase, kept here for convenience.

vault phrase of tajef-tafog = istox-sorax-zorox-casok-holox-kelix-weneth-drueth-casion

# Env file — Cartwheel dispatch, driver-assignment heuristic
# Scope: staging only. Do not promote to prod.
# The heuristic weights (proximity, shift balance, refusal rate) are tuned
# for the Velmont pilot region and will misbehave elsewhere.
# Review notes: heuristic service runs unprivileged; it reads weights
# read-only from the tuning store and writes nothing back.
# Only one sensitive value exists in this file: the tuning-store access
# credential, consumed at boot and never logged.
# That credential is set on the following line.

secret setting of faduf-bahop: LEDGER_TOKEN8=c3b363be

Team,

We're promoting Forklane v2.8 to production tomorrow morning. The change set is limited to the deterministic bucketing refactor reviewed last week; assignment outputs were verified identical against 2.7 on a replay of two weeks of staging traffic. Exposure logging and the kill-switch path are untouched. Reviewers, please give the diff a final pass today, focusing on the hash-seed handling. Rollback is a redeploy of 2.7, no data migration. The candidate's trace token appears below.

— Priya

pipeline stamp: htk4_ae36